Introduction:
In today’s data-driven world, organizations face ever-increasing demands for scalability, high availability, and global data access. Traditional single-master replication architectures in PostgreSQL are no longer sufficient to meet these evolving needs. This blog explores the significance of adopting multi-master replication in PostgreSQL, highlighting its ability to empower businesses with enhanced scalability, resilience, and efficient data distribution across geographically dispersed environments.
Harnessing the Strengths of the Postgres Ecosystem: Upcoming native Support and Feature Integration Seamless Integration with Existing Tools and Extensions Robust Management and Monitoring Capabilities
- Achieving Unprecedented/Ultra High Availability
- Multi-Master replication allows multiple nodes to accept both read and write operations simultaneously, eliminating the single point of failure associated with traditional single-master architectures.
- Organizations can ensure continuous availability of their critical applications and services, even in the face of node failures or maintenance operations.
- Scaling Beyond Horizons
- The ability to distribute read and write operations across multiple nodes empowers organizations to scale their database systems horizontally.
- Multi-master replication unlocks the potential for handling high volumes of concurrent requests, supporting growing user bases and workloads.
- Geographical Distribution and Reduced Latency
- With Multi-Master replication, organizations can deploy database nodes in different geographical regions, bringing data closer to end-users.
- Local writes on distributed nodes result in reduced latency, providing a seamless experience for users regardless of their location.
- Enhanced Data Consistency and Conflict Resolution
- Multi-Master replication provides sophisticated conflict resolution mechanisms to handle concurrent updates on multiple nodes.
- This ensures data integrity and consistency across the distributed system, maintaining a single source of truth for applications and users.
- Supporting Active-Active Architectures
- Organizations require the flexibility to distribute data modifications across multiple nodes in active-active architectures.
- Multi-Master replication facilitates de-centralized writes, empowering businesses to design resilient and scalable systems that can handle distributed workloads.
- Future-Proofing Database Infrastructure
- Implementing Multi-Master replication in PostgreSQL future-proofs database infrastructure by adopting a scalable and highly available architecture.
- Organizations can adapt to evolving business needs, such as accommodating increased user demands, expanding into new markets, or integrating with partner systems.
Conclusion
PostgreSQL’s multi-master replication is no longer a luxury but a necessity for organizations striving to deliver high-performance, fault-tolerant, and globally scalable applications. By embracing Multi-Master replication, businesses can achieve unprecedented levels of high availability, scalability, and data consistency, empowering them to meet the demands of a rapidly evolving digital landscape. PostgreSQL’s robust support for multi-master replication positions it as a leading choice for organizations seeking to build resilient and future-proof database infrastructures.
Leave a Reply